Title: San Bernardino California Complaint for Negligence — Fraud and Deceptive Trade Practices in Sale of Insurance — Jury Trial Demand Keywords: San Bernardino California, complaint, negligence, fraud, deceptive trade practices, sale of insurance, jury trial demand, insurance fraud, consumer protection, personal injury, insurance company, compensation, legal action Description: The San Bernardino California Complaint for Negligence — Fraud and Deceptive Trade Practices in Sale of Insurance — Jury Trial Demand is a legal document filed by individuals or entities seeking justice and compensation for damages caused by insurance fraud and deceptive trade practices. It aims to hold insurance companies accountable for engaging in fraudulent activities and violating consumer protection laws. In San Bernardino, California, insurance fraud is a serious offense that not only affects the victims but also undermines the integrity of the insurance industry as a whole. This complaint alleges negligence, fraud, and deceptive trade practices pertaining to the sale of insurance policies in San Bernardino, California. Insurance fraud can take various forms, including misrepresentation of policy terms, providing false information, or deliberately denying legitimate claims. These fraudulent activities often result in significant financial, emotional, and physical damages to policyholders and beneficiaries. The complaint seeks compensation for victims who have suffered personal injuries, financial losses, or other adverse effects due to the insurance company's fraudulent actions. Furthermore, it requests a jury trial to present the evidence and arguments before a panel of impartial individuals who will ultimately determine the outcome of the case. Types of San Bernardino California Complaints for Negligence — Fraud and Deceptive Trade Practices in Sale of Insurance — Jury Trial Demand may include: 1. Individual or Family Health Insurance Fraud: This type of complaint focuses on cases where individuals or families have been victims of insurance fraud related to health coverage, such as illegitimate denials of claims or unnecessary coverage limitations. 2. Auto Insurance Fraud: This complaint type involves cases where policyholders have been deceived by insurance companies selling auto insurance policies, resulting in denied claims, exaggerated premiums, and unfair practices. 3. Homeowners or Property Insurance Fraud: These complaints register instances of fraud and deceptive trade practices concerning homeowners or property insurance policies, including undervalued claims, delays in claim processing, or misrepresentation of coverage terms. 4. Business or Commercial Insurance Fraud: This type of complaint targets instances of fraud and deceptive trade practices within the commercial insurance sector, affecting businesses of all sizes. It may involve issues related to liability coverage, property damage claims, or workers' compensation. 5. Life Insurance Fraud: Complaints pertaining to life insurance fraud address situations where beneficiaries or policyholders have been deceived or wrongly denied benefits, withholding rightful compensation after the death of the insured. In conclusion, the San Bernardino California Complaint for Negligence — Fraud and Deceptive Trade Practices in Sale of Insurance — Jury Trial Demand highlights the pressing need for justice and compensation in cases involving insurance fraud and deceptive trade practices. It aims to protect the rights of consumers and promote accountability within the insurance industry through legal action and jury trial demands.
